It's been a little while since I posted, but I have still been getting out this month and doing some detecting. Since yesterday, we had 7 straight days of on-off rain here in S. CA. Some areas are very muddy, but very easy digging, and lots of new, deep signals in my pounded areas. Today, I found my 32 nd silver coin of the month so far, along with over 200 wheats. My oldest silver so far is the 1899 barber dime, and my smallest silver ever is the piece of merc in the upper right that I found today. That cut merc sounded like a deep Indian Head penny, so I decided to dig it, and couldn't believe when I saw the small piece of silver coin in my hole.

Another interesting item in my pic is the wheatie that I dug last week. I've never seen another one like it. Have any of you? Looks like there is a picture of a moose on the little silver that is bored into the coin. The carved out area on the top of the coin looks like it was made into a pendant for a necklace. Yeah, halfdime, I thought it was illegal to deface US coinage also. There are a lot of cut coins in all the parks I hunt. Also a lot of trash. I've been moving my coil real slow in heavy trashy areas. The cut merc was being masked by trash, but I heard the slightly higher tone....sounded like an early wheat or IH, but it could have easily been a piece of wheatie or one of the many bullets I find at these parks.
